About the Bombardier Challenger 300
The Bombardier Challenger 300 is the original super-midsize jet that opened the super-mid category in 2004 — twin Honeywell HTF7000 engines, transcontinental range (~3,100 nm), stand-up flat-floor cabin and cruise around 459 kt. Produced 2003-2014 before being upgraded to the Challenger 350 in 2014. The 300 is the workhorse super-mid on the used market: large fleet, broad maintenance support, and lower acquisition costs than newer 350/3500 generations.
